Welcome to the International Conference on “Autism & Related Disorders

 

We are delighted to welcome you to International Conference on “Autism & Related Disorders”(Autism 2026) during May14-16, 2026 at Bedok, Singapore —an international platform dedicated to advancing knowledge, sharing research, and promoting collaborative strategies in the field of Autism Autism & Related Disorders.

 

The Autism 2026 will cover a broad spectrum of topics, including early diagnosis and intervention, behavioral and educational therapies, neurodevelopment research, technology-assisted solutions, mental health support, and inclusive societal practices. Through keynote presentations, panel discussions, interactive workshops, and poster sessions, attendees will gain cutting-edge insights and build meaningful professional connections.

 

Whether you are a healthcare professional, educator, academic, caregiver, or someone personally impacted by autism, this Autism Conference offers a unique opportunity to engage with experts, discover innovative tools, and contribute to the global effort to enhance understanding and support for individuals on the autism spectrum.
